Fuzzy operator logic and fuzzy resolution
Journal of Automated Reasoning, 1993The paper presents an attempt to adapt resolution-based theorem proving techniques to fuzzy modelling of uncertainty. Within the first two sections, some general arguments are supplied to justify the approach. The FOpL calculus (Fuzzy Operator Logic) is introduced in the next section.

Fuzzy Logic and the Resolution Principle [PDF]
ABSTRACT The relationship between fuzzy logic and two-valued logic in the context of the first order predicate calculus is discussed. It is proved that if every clause in a set of clauses is something more than a “half-truth” and the most reliable clause has truth-value a and the most unreliable clause has truth-value b , then we are guaranteed ...
